How AI Cuts Food Waste in Working Kitchens

AI reduces food waste through two complementary mechanisms. Upstream prevention uses automated invoice scanning and live dish-costing to flag price changes, correct over-ordering, and keep recipe margins accurate in real time. This stops waste before stock is purchased or prepared. Downstream measurement uses computer vision and smart scales to record what is discarded, then feeds that data into future purchasing and prep decisions.

ReFED’s 2026 AI report identifies the most effective AI applications as those that shift decisions upstream to forecasting and inventory planning phases, where prevention is still possible. The same report notes that AI’s most consistent contribution is improving visibility into waste and demand, enabling earlier and more precise decision-making.

The UK hospitality sector incurs an estimated £3.2 billion annually in food waste costs, and around 75% of the sector’s food waste by weight is considered avoidable. UK restaurants can lose a large share of their inventory value to waste, shrinkage, and administrative errors. Upstream automation that connects invoice data directly to recipe costs and POS sales converts much of that avoidable 75% into recoverable margin.

Orbisk, Winnow, and Leanpath operate as downstream measurement tools that quantify waste after it occurs. MarketMan and Jelly sit upstream as inventory automation platforms that prevent waste by tightening purchasing and costing decisions. Foodservice pilots that combine AI measurement with demand forecasting show stronger food waste cost reductions than single-layer deployments, which supports a combined approach for operators with the budget and scale.

How does AI reduce food waste in restaurants and cafeterias?

AI reduces food waste through two distinct mechanisms. Upstream, AI-powered inventory automation scans supplier invoices in real time, updates recipe costs automatically, and alerts operators to price changes. That combination supports purchasing decisions that prevent over-ordering and uncosted margin erosion before stock is received. Downstream, computer vision systems and smart scales identify and weigh discarded food at the point of disposal, creating data on what is being wasted and why. In cafeterias and high-volume kitchens, downstream tools such as Winnow and Leanpath work well because overproduction is the dominant waste driver. In independent restaurants and pubs, upstream automation usually delivers faster ROI because it focuses on purchasing accuracy and supplier price management, which are the main sources of inventory value loss for most UK operators.

What measurable waste reduction percentages have UK restaurants achieved with AI?

Results vary by tool type and by how actively teams use the data. Vision-based tracking systems such as Winnow report that kitchens typically reduce waste by over 50% in the first year, with 2–8% reductions in food costs. ReFED’s 2026 AI report cites real-world deployments of commercial foodservice AI measurement systems achieving substantial waste reductions, with stronger outcomes when management engages closely with the insights.
